Drinking Water Filtration in Charlotte, NC

Drinking water filtration services involve the installation, replacement, and maintenance of systems designed to improve the quality of tap water for residential properties. These services typically cover a range of projects, including installing whole-house filtration units, under-sink filters, and point-of-use systems to reduce contaminants such as chlorine, sediment, lead, and other impurities. Homeowners often seek these services to ensure their drinking water is clean, safe, and tastes better, especially in areas where water quality may be affected by local sources or aging plumbing infrastructure.

Property owners considering drinking water filtration services usually want to understand the types of filtration options available, the benefits of each system, and how they can address specific water quality concerns. It’s important to evaluate the size and capacity of the system needed for the household, as well as any maintenance requirements. Clear information about the installation process, system longevity, and potential improvements in water clarity and taste can help homeowners make informed decisions about enhancing their home's water quality.

Project Types

Common Drinking Water Filtration Jobs

Whole house filtration systems - improve water quality for every tap in the home.

Reverse osmosis units - remove contaminants for cleaner drinking water.

Point-of-use filters - target specific faucets for enhanced water safety.

Sediment and particulate filters - reduce dirt and debris from household water.

Water softening systems - reduce hard water buildup and mineral deposits.

Maintenance and replacement services - ensure filtration systems operate effectively over time.

FAQ

Drinking Water Filtration Questions

What types of drinking water filtration systems are available? There are various options including point-of-use filters, reverse osmosis units, and whole-house systems designed to improve water quality throughout a property.

How do I know if my water needs filtration? Signs include unusual tastes, odors, or discoloration in the water, as well as concerns about contaminants or mineral buildup.

What contaminants can water filtration remove? Filtration can reduce common impurities such as chlorine, lead, sediment, bacteria, and certain chemicals to improve water safety and taste.

Are maintenance requirements for drinking water filters complicated? Maintenance typically involves regular filter replacements and system checks to ensure continued effectiveness and water quality.
